In a shocking U-turn to Qatar World Cup organisers’ move to allow the sale of beer at all eight stadiums, now hosts are reportedly asking FIFA to stop the sale of the alcoholic drink.
As per the Guardian’s report, the world cup hosts now want to go even further and that discussions are ongoing between Fifa and Budweiser.
Generally in Qatar, public drunkenness is punishable by hefty fines and jailing. But the head of Qatar’s security operations has said that during the tournament, police will turn a blind eye to most offenses but potentially make arrests if someone gets into a drunken brawl or damages public property.
